King Charles III Showcases Commonwealth’s Cultural Diversity with Davido on His Music Playlist

King Charles III has once again highlighted the rich cultural diversity of the Commonwealth through music, unveiling a specially curated playlist that features Nigerian superstar Davido.
The newly released King’s Music Room playlist, revealed earlier today, celebrates a blend of global sounds personally selected by the British monarch. Among the standout tracks is Kante, Davido’s collaboration with Fave, further solidifying Afrobeats’ growing impact on the world stage.
The playlist also boasts an impressive lineup of legendary artists, including reggae icon Bob Marley, pop star Kylie Minogue, the ever-stylish Grace Jones, and the late South African music legend Miriam Makeba.

Speaking on his song choices, King Charles III shared his inspiration behind the selection. “I wanted to share with you songs which have brought me joy. They evoke many different styles and many different cultures. But all of them, like the family of Commonwealth nations, in their many different ways, share the same love of life in all its richness and diversity.”
The monarch also reflected on his past visit to Nigeria, expressing his appreciation for the country’s vibrant culture. “I remember attempting to give a speech in Nigerian Pidgin English, and the warmth of the people was truly unforgettable,” he recalled.
For Davido, this recognition adds another milestone to his already illustrious career. His Grammy-nominated album Timeless continues to garner global success, further cementing his place as a key figure in Afrobeats.
With Afrobeats now making its mark on such an exclusive platform, its influence on international music continues to grow. King Charles III hopes his playlist brings listeners the same joy it has brought him. “Perhaps you have heard some of your own favorite pieces—and perhaps you may have discovered something new,” he remarked.
